Name: Ordinance of the Ministry of Emergency Situations No. 133 of 29 December 2008 to approve the Occupational Safety System Statute.
Country: Belarus
Subject(s): Occupational safety and health
Type of legislation: Regulation, Decree, Ordinance
Adopted on: 2008-01-18
Entry into force:
Published on: Natsional'nyi Reestr Pravovykh Aktov, 2008-02-25, No. 43, pp. 94-99
ISN: BLR-2008-R-78462
Link: https://www.ilo.org/dyn/natlex/natlex4.detail?p_isn=78462&p_lang=en
Bibliography: Natsional'nyi Reestr Pravovykh Aktov, 2008-02-25, No. 43, pp. 94-99
Abstract/Citation: Refers to the Law of 29 December 2006 No. 756 on some questions related to the Ministry of Emergency Situations. Defines the main objectives of the occupational safety system, its functions and organizational structure.
